Abstract:
This article describes the graduate student training in RCR that was implemented during the creation of the Ethics Education Library. It includes a bibliography of topics discussed including Codes of Ethics, Intellectual Property & Copyright Issues, Fair Use, Privacy & Security, and Site Accessibility.
